diff --git a/.github/workflows/bindgen.yml b/.github/workflows/bindgen.yml index 94022c21e1..1778de1d2b 100644 --- a/.github/workflows/bindgen.yml +++ b/.github/workflows/bindgen.yml @@ -66,12 +66,7 @@ jobs: steps: - uses: actions/checkout@v4 - - name: Install stable - uses: dtolnay/rust-toolchain@master - with: - toolchain: stable - - - name: Check without default features + - name: Check without default features run: cargo check -p bindgen --no-default-features --features=runtime docs: @@ -81,12 +76,7 @@ jobs: steps: - uses: actions/checkout@v4 - - name: Install stable - uses: dtolnay/rust-toolchain@master - with: - toolchain: stable - - - name: Generate documentation for `bindgen` + - name: Generate documentation for `bindgen` run: cargo doc --document-private-items --no-deps -p bindgen - name: Generate documentation for `bindgen-cli` @@ -97,11 +87,6 @@ jobs: steps: - uses: actions/checkout@v4 - - name: Install stable - uses: dtolnay/rust-toolchain@master - with: - toolchain: stable - # TODO: Actually run quickchecks once `bindgen` is reliable enough. - name: Build quickcheck tests run: cd bindgen-tests/tests/quickchecking && cargo test @@ -114,11 +99,6 @@ jobs: steps: - uses: actions/checkout@v4 - - name: Install stable - uses: dtolnay/rust-toolchain@master - with: - toolchain: stable - - name: Test expectations run: cd bindgen-tests/tests/expectations && cargo test